        New Year celebrations is a grand event of China. New Year festivities lasts for one month in China. Chinese New Year is also called Springfestival. It begins from the middle of the last month of the year and ends up in the first month of the new year. These last day celebrationsin China is called Lantern Festival。

        欢庆新年是中国的一次盛会。在中国欢庆新年会持续一个月。中国新年也被称作春节。它起始于一年最后一个月的中旬,结束于新年的第一个月。在中国组后一天庆祝活动被称作元宵节。 

  History of Chinese New Year

  追溯历史:名叫“年”的怪兽

ChineseNew Year has a very interesting and unique history. According to theChinese legends, there was a giant beast Nian who used to swallowhumans in a single bite. Relief from the horrifying beast came onlywhen people realized that Nian was scared of red color and loud noises.They started bursting crackers and used red color to scare the beast. Since then, this day was namedas GuNian meaning "Pass over the Nian". Chinese considered the day an auspicious one as it brought new life for them and celebrated it as a New Year。

中国新年有一个非常有趣和特别的历史。根据中国的传说,从前有一个经常出来吃人的野兽。只有当人们意识到叫作‘年’的野兽害怕红色和噪音那时起,才解除了害怕野兽到来的痛苦。他们开始放鞭炮和用红色来吓走野兽。从那时候起,这一天被称作过年的日子,意味着赶走了‘年那个野兽’。中国人把这一天看做吉祥的一天,因为它给人们带来了新生活,故在这一天庆祝新年的到来。

  Chinese New Year Dates

  农历新年,年年不同

Chinese New Year falls on a different date every year. Chinese calendar is a combination of solar and lunar calendar. Chinese New Year falls on second new moon after the winter solstice(冬至). Chinese calendar has a 12 year cycle and each year is named after animal. Chinese believe that every person resembles an animal and this reflects their traits. Year 2006 was the Year of the Dog. People born on this date are said to be very loyal and trustworthy。

农历新年的日期,年年不同。中国历是阳历和阴历的结合。冬至之后的第二个新月是中国春节。中国农历有12年的周期,每一年以一个动物命名。中国人相信每个人像他的属相,属相反映了他们的个性。2006年是狗年,在狗年出生的人据说是非常忠诚和可信的。 

  Chinese New Year Celebrations

  新年找乐,日日不同

Lot of excitement can be seen in the last 15 days of New Year celebrations. Every day has a special importance to it. Chinese ritualize and celebrate each day in a customary manner. Given below are the line wise celebrations of the New Year in China:

在持续15天的庆祝新年活动中可以看到许多令人兴奋的事物。对于春节,每一天都有特殊的重要性。中国人把节日仪式化了,以通常方式庆祝每一天。以下是中国庆祝新年的明智方式。

  年初一:祭拜天地

Day1: People began their day by offering prayers and welcome the gods ofheaven and earth. Most of the people stay away from meat to ensurehealthy living。

人们通过送祝福和欢迎天地神仙开始这一天。大多数人远离肉食来确保健康生活。

  年初二:狗狗过生日

Day 2:Successively, prayers are offer to their ancestors and other gods.Chinese are strict care-taker of dogs and feed them well. This is dayis considered to be the birthday of all dogs。

祝福连续送给祖先和其它神。中国人对狗的照看很细心,喂它们吃的食物也很好,初二被看做是所有狗狗的生日。

  初三初四:走亲访友,媳妇回娘家

Day3 and 4: These are very important days for the families to keep up their relations. It calls for every son-in-law to pay respect to theirparents-in-law。

初三初四:这些天对于家庭来说维持关系来说很重要,它要求每个女婿在这一天拜访岳父岳母。

  年初五:“破五”祭财神

Day5: According to the traditions, nobody visits friends and relativeshouses as it would bring bad omen. They stay back home to worship theGod of wealth. The day is called Po Woo。

初五:根据传统,没人在这一天走亲访友,因为会带来凶兆。他们会呆在家里祭财神,这一天也被称作‘破五’。

  年初六:百无禁忌,出门活动筋骨

Day6: On this day, people freely meet their near and dear ones and even visit nearby temples to pray for their well being and high spirits。

初六:在这一天,人们可以自由的会见远亲和近邻,甚至去附近寺庙祈福。

  年初七:吃面条,祝长寿

  Day 7: This is Chinese farmers' day. They display their backbreaking

produce. They also prepare a drink from seven different types of vegetables. On this day, everybody eats noodles which is a symbol oflong life and fish representing success。

正月初七是中国的人胜节,展示了他们的辛劳付出,他们也准备由七种蔬菜榨成的饮料。在这一天,每人吃长寿面和代表着成功的鱼。

  年初八:凌晨拜天公

Day8: It's an other day to be celebrated with the family and friends. Theyalso offer midnight prayers to Tian Gong, the God of Heaven。

初八:这是与家人和朋友度过的又一天。他们也给天神‘天公’送去午夜祝福。

  年初九:玉皇大帝登场

Day 9: Prayers are offered to Jade Emperor。

把祝福送给玉皇大帝。

  初十、十一、十二、十三:大吃大喝,最后记得回归清淡

Days 10 to 13: From 10 to 12, people celebrate the days by having sumptuous dinner with the loved ones and the 13th day is left for a very light dinner to cleanse the system。

正月初十至十二,人们和相爱的人一起吃丰盛大餐度过,为了净化肠道系统,十三吃清淡的饭菜。

  年十四:准备闹元宵

Day 14: People start preparing for the celebration of Lantern Festival to be held on next day。

 年十四:人们开始准备在第二天举行的元宵佳节相关东西。

  年十五:吃元宵看灯火

Day 15: Since it is the first night to see full moon, people hang out colorful lanterns, eat glutinous rice balls and enjoy the day with their families

正月十五:因为这是第一个看到满月的晚上,人们挂出五颜六色的灯笼,边吃tangyuan 边和家人一起度过元宵节。
